DEVELOPMENT AND VALIDATION OF UV SPECTROPHOTOMETRIC METHOD FOR QUANTITATIVE ESTIMATION OF BALSALAZIDE FROM CAPSULE FORMULATION
Naveen Kumar G.S.*, Dinesh M., Gokul Nanda G. and Hanumanthachar Joshi
Abstract Balsalazide is an anti-inflammatory drug used in the treatment of inflammatory bowel disease. It is usually administered as the disodium salt. New, simple and sensitive spectrophotometric methods for the determination of balsalazide have been developed for the quantitative estimation of from balsalazide capsule dosage form. The method was developed and based on the solubility of balsalazide in 0.1 N NaOH. The drug showed maximum absorbance at 454 nm and linearity (Lambert Beer’s Range) was found in concentration range of 10-100 μg/ml and the standard curve equation was found to be y = 0.015x – 0.015 and R2 value 0.998. The results of analysis were validated statistically and by recovery studies. The result of analysis was validated as per ICH guidelines and this method can be used for the routine analysis of balsalazide formulation. Keywords: Balsalazide, 0.1 N NaOH, UV method, Validation.
